NASCIC has the mission to bring about unified achievements in research, care &policy by supporting collaborative efforts across the spinal cord injury community

As we know, spinal cord injuries can impact your bowel routine and make it more difficult to manage. Fortunately, the Navina Irrigation System by our partners at @WellspectHC is can help you take control of bowel irrigation easily and effectively by introducing lukewarm water.
